Gold prices near record highs amid escalating geopolitical tensions


(MENAFN) Gold prices surged on Wednesday, edging closer to record levels, as escalating geopolitical tensions in the Middle East drove investors towards the safe haven asset. The increasing risk of conflict expansion in the region prompted a flight to safety, with gold emerging as a preferred choice for investors seeking refuge from market uncertainty. Additionally, short-term declines in the value of the dollar and US Treasury bond yields further bolstered gold prices, reinforcing its appeal as a store of value.

In immediate trading, gold rose by 0.3 percent to reach USD2,389.38 per ounce by 1014 GMT, nearing the all-time high of USD2,431.29 achieved just days prior on Friday. Meanwhile, US gold futures experienced a slight dip of 0.1 percent, settling at USD2,405.10. The remarkable ascent in gold prices reflects the prevailing market sentiment characterized by heightened geopolitical risks and cautious optimism among investors.

Lukman Otunuga, senior research analyst at FXTM, highlighted the significant overbought conditions observed in the precious metal from a technical standpoint. He noted that while optimistic investors draw strength from market uncertainties fueled by geopolitical factors, concerns persist over the impact on data and monetary policy expectations. The prevailing uncertainty underscores the pivotal role of gold as a reliable asset in times of geopolitical instability and economic volatility.

The retreat in the dollar and ten-year Treasury bond yields from their recent highs provided additional support to gold prices. This dynamic rendered the yellow metal, priced in US currency, less attractive to holders of other currencies, further driving demand for gold as a hedge against currency depreciation and financial market turbulence.

Overall, the surge in gold prices reflects the complex interplay of geopolitical tensions, market uncertainties, and shifting monetary policy expectations. Against this backdrop, gold continues to assert its status as a preferred safe haven asset, offering investors a shield against the inherent risks and uncertainties prevailing in global financial markets.
